Many football fans had anticipated an end-to-end match with great action and some goals but the game ended in a disappointing 0-0 draw. The match presented a great opportunity for City Polar to go back to the top if they came out victorious but failed to get the much needed goals.
Notwane also had the chance to open up the gap but the two sides remain level on points. However, Notwane's assistant coach, Kanyenga Kashiwa was left elated by the point they picked.
